I like a lot of light when I'm turning. It really makes turning for me more enjoyable. I have a couple of the IKEA lights with homemade magnet mounts that are popular and they are nice but my big gun is an LED loading dock light. This thing is great. I got an open box deal from Amazon for around 1/2 price and it turned out to be brand new with just a slightly torn box.

I have seen a lot of discussions on various groups over the years on lathe lights and wanted to suggest this as an option.

I have two 45 inch LED tubes above my lathe. 300 watt equivalent light output (3800 lumens) for 48 watts. It has a motion detector in it and turns on when I go into the shop and turns off ten minutes after I leave. It says operating temperature up to 104 degrees F. But it worked all summer with temps well above that.

I have a set of cabinets above the lathe and the light is mounted on the underside of the cabinets.

Just checked and it is available at COSTCO for $40.
